Foundation problems can lead to a variety of structural concerns within a property. Common issues include uneven or cracked floors, sticking doors and windows, vis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self, and sloping or sinking floors. If left unaddressed, these issues may result in significant damage to the property’s structure, costly repairs, and safety hazards. Foundation repair services help resolve these problems by restoring the foundation’s stability and preventing further movement or damage.
These services are applicable to a range of property types, including residential homes, multi-family dwellings, and small commercial buildings. Older properties often experience foundation settling or shifting due to age and soil conditions, while newer constructions might encounter issues related to improper installation or soil movement. Foundation Repair Cost -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may cost around $2,000, while more extensive work can exceed $7,500 in areas like Schaumburg, IL. Costs vary based on the size and severity of the foundation issues.
Repair Method Expenses - Different repair methods influence overall costs; underpinning may start at $3,000, whereas pier and beam repairs can range up to $10,000 or more. The choice of method depends on the foundation type and damage severity, affecting the final price.
Material and Labor Costs - Material prices for foundation repairs typically range from $1,000 to $5,000, with labor adding an additional $1,000 to $3,000. Variations depend on project complexity and local labor rates in Schaumburg, IL area.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, inspections, or addressing related structural issues can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These factors depend on local regulations and the specific needs of the repair project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How do professionals typically repair foundation issues?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, depending on the severity and type of foundation problem.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age and rep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a few weeks.
